Synopsis

Each act chronicles the events of a day in the lives of ten high school students.

Through their conversations with each other, and occasional monologues to the audience, we learn a little about their lives, and also about their hopes, ambitions, fears, and doubts.

It turns out that they are all plagued by insecurities that the people around them may or may not be aware of.

The three days featured are all several weeks apart, so we see the ways their lives change over a period of time, and how the changes that take place affect them.

All of the characters in the play are aged between fourteen and seventeen.
